Roland Verhavert
Belgian film director (1927–2014)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Roland Verhavert (1 May 1927 – 26 July 2014) was a Belgian film director. He directed 44 films between 1955 and 1993. He co-directed the 1955 film Seagulls Die in the Harbour, which was entered into the 1956 Cannes Film Festival.[1] His 1974 film The Conscript was entered into the 24th Berlin International Film Festival.[2]
Verhavert died of a heart attack aged 87 in July 2014.[3]

Selected filmography
- Seagulls Die in the Harbour (1955)
- The Conscript (1974)
- Rubens (1977)
- Brugge, die stille (1981)
